
Geographic Expansion Community Launch & Engagement Specialist
Huntington Bank, Charlotte, NC, United States
# **Description****Job Description: Geographic Expansion Community Launch & Engagement Specialist****Overview**The Geographic Expansion team is seeking a highly organized, proactive, and detail‐oriented Community Launch & Engagement Specialist to support the planning, communication, and execution of Community Launch events across multiple markets.This role partners closely with local teams, cross‐functional partners, and external vendors to ensure seamless event preparation, exceptional launch experiences, and strong community engagement. The Specialist manages logistics, facilitates meetings, and supports the operational readiness necessary for successful events.**Key Responsibilities****Project & Calendar Coordination*** Maintain updates to the master Community Launch calendar and overall project timelines.* Schedule and support planning meetings with internal partners and external collaborators.* Manage the Community Launch inbox, providing timely responses and follow‐through.* Track deliverables, tasks, and updates using Microsoft Planner and other project tools.**Planning & Stakeholder Coordination*** Confirm event date, timing, and branch‐specific needs, working with the local team on preferences.* Coordinate early vision discussions to align on goals, themes, and expected outcomes.* Facilitate approvals related to parking, logistics, or operational adjustments.* Distribute and maintain the Community Launch toolkit.* Coordinate with Marketing to secure creative assets.* Manage spend and budget tracking in partnership with the Regional Marketing Manager.**Vendor & Logistics Coordination*** Research and secure vendors in collaboration with local teams, with a preference for Huntington customer and prospect partners.* Maintain a comprehensive vendor tracking system to monitor all booked services, ordered materials, delivery timelines, and fulfillment status throughout the planning process.* Manage relationships and logistics with vendors.**Run‐of‐Show & Event Preparedness*** Develop and finalize the event Run‐of‐Show timelines, and responsibilities.* Conduct final reviews and distribute updated materials to involved partners.**Invitation & Guest Experience Management*** Prepare and distribute Community Launch invitation.* Coordinate with local teams to manage RSVPs.* Support the Founder’s Circle selection process and oversee plaque production and ordering.* Creation and distribution of “Know Before You Go” communications.**Event-Day Support***(On‐site attendance as business need dictates)** Bring and organize all required event materials and supplies.* Manage all event setup/teardown.* Lead on‐site event day coordination as the primary point of contact, ensuring smooth execution.**Post‐Event Coordination*** Collect and organize event photos from the Greenhouse team or contracted photographers.* Participate in post‐event debrief sessions to discuss outcomes, learnings, and opportunities.* Document insights to enhance future Community Launch experiences.**Administrative & Operational Support*** Maintain organized digital files, templates, and communication assets.* Support process improvements and updates to Community Launch documents, toolkits, and workflows.* Assist with special projects and initiatives aligned to team priorities.* Provide administrative support as needed to the Geographic Expansion team.**Location & Travel Requirements****Residency Requirement**Specialist must reside in Charlotte, North Carolina.**Market/Region Coverage**This role is accountable for supporting Community Launches and engagement activities across:* North Carolina* South Carolina* *Note:* as the Carolinas expansion matures, this role will assume additional responsibilities supporting future market growth and geographic expansion efforts across newly developing regions. Candidate must be adaptable to evolving business needs.**Travel Expectations**The position requires approximately 30% travel within the assigned market region to support events, meetings, site visits, and vendor coordination.**Basic Qualifications:*** Bachelor’s Degree* 4+ years of experience in community development, financial education, or related field.**Preferred Qualifications:*** Knowledge of CRA requirements and community engagement best practices.* Strong communication and presentation skills, including experience with diverse audiences.* Proficiency in Microsoft Office and data visualization tools.* Ability to manage multiple priorities and work independently or collaboratively.* Experience in program execution and outcome measurement preferred.* Must be able to travel and work flexible hours including some overnight stays and Saturdays**Exempt Status: (Yes** = not eligible for overtime pay) (**No** = eligible for overtime pay)Yes**Workplace Type:**OfficeOur Approach to **Office** Workplace TypeCertain positions outside our branch network may be eligible for a flexible work arrangement.
